Aegea Creates Brazil's Largest 3D Digital Sanitation Map As Part Of Their Intelligent Infrastructure Program

By Aude Camus, Senior Product Marketing Manager, Bentley Systems

aegea2

Controlling water and sewage utilities in 489 municipalities in Brazil, Aegea is committed to improving sanitation processes through advanced technology and digitization. Their goal is to facilitate network modernization to ensure access to clean water for over 30 million people.

Aligned with these goals, they launched their intelligent infrastructure program, Infra Inteligente, to create a virtual environment, digitally mapping the structures that they operate. As part of this smart digitization program, Aegea implemented Brazil’s largest asset inventory project in Rio de Janeiro, covering water and sewage treatment plants, pump stations, tanks, and other assets spread across 27 municipalities.

Using Bentley’s ContextCapture and open applications, Agea processed drone-captured photos to generate a 3D reality mesh and digital map of their plants and assets, as well as integrating the captured historical and real-time asset data. The result was a highly interactive 3D map representing over 1,000 sanitation facilities in a virtual reality environment which optimizes performance, service availability, and reliability, while mitigating risks and achieving operational efficiencies to provide a sustainable clean water supply to Brazil’s communities.
